Older than both the Egyptian pyramids and Stonehenge, Skara Brae is the shining star of the Heart Of Neolithic Orkney. Dating back some 5,000 years ago, this Neolithic settlement was discovered in 1850 by the Laird of Skaill after a vicious storm stripped the grass from the mound that concealed the ruins.
